Mujra: Historically, mujra is a traditional South Asian dance form that originated during the Mughal era. It was performed by courtesans (tawaifs) and combined classical Kathak dance elements with Hindustani music, such as thumris and ghazals. In its classical form, it was a respected art of etiquette and conversation.
Modern Usage: In modern popular culture, the term has often shifted to mean exotic or provocative performances often held in private or at specialized venues known as kothas.

Mujra is a traditional form of dance that originated during the Mughal era in the Indian subcontinent. Historically, it was a sophisticated art form performed by tawaifs (courtesans) for the royalty and elite, blending elements of Kathak dance with soulful Ghazals or semi-classical music. Evolution into Modern "Stage Dance"
In recent decades, the traditional Mujra has evolved into what is commonly known as Pakistani Stage Dance, particularly popular in Punjab.

Historically, Mujra was a sophisticated performance art. In the Mughal era, tawaifs (highly trained courtesans) were the custodians of music, poetry, and Kathak dance [5, 6]. They were not merely dancers; they were trendsetters in etiquette and literature [5].
However, the colonial era and subsequent social reforms stripped the art of its prestige. What was once a high-culture performance in private salons (kothas) eventually migrated to public theaters and, eventually, cinema [4, 6]. The Cinematic Evolution: Pakistan and India
In the mid-20th century, both Pakistani and Indian cinema integrated Mujra as a storytelling device [2].
In Pakistan: The Punjabi film industry (Lollywood) became famous for its high-energy stage performances [3]. Dancers like Anjuman and Saima became icons, though the style shifted from classical Kathak toward a more commercial and bold folk-pop fusion [3, 4].
In India: Bollywood reimagined the Mujra through legendary performances in films like Pakeezah and Umrao Jaan. These versions favored aesthetic beauty and poetic depth, keeping the classical spirit alive for a global audience [5]. The Digital Era and the "Collection" Culture

Mujra is a traditional South Asian performance art that originated in the 15th-century Mughal courts, blending Hindustani classical music with elements of Kathak dance. While historically a high-art form for the elite, modern interpretations—often categorized as "collections" on digital platforms—have shifted toward more commercial and provocative stage performances. Historical Significance & Evolution
Royal Origins: Historically, the tawaif (courtesan) was an educated entertainer who embodied Farsi and Urdu literature, poetry, and refined social conduct.
The Shift: During British colonial rule, the status of these dancers was systematically stripped, leading to the stigmatization of the art form and its eventual association with the red-light districts like Heera Mandi in Lahore.
